You will be informed with the first installment of Thor movies on Facts about Thor. It was released in the market in 2011. Paramount Pictures served as the distributor of the movie. On the other hand, Marvel Studios were the producer. Thor is adapted from the Marvel Comics. Kenneth Branagh was the director of the movie. Facts about Thor 1: the cast
Chris Hemsworth took the role as Thor. He shared screen with Tom Hiddleston, Natalie Portman, Colm Feore, Stellan Skarsgård, Rene Russo, Kat Dennings, Idris Elba, and Anthony Hopkins and Ray Stevenson.
Facts about Thor 2: the plot
Thor was sent to earth. He lost all of his power and his hammer Mjölnir. Asgard was ruled by his brother Loki. He was against Thor.

Facts about Thor 3: the development of Thor
In 1991, Thor was developed into a film by Sam Raimi. However, he left the project. The concept was neglected for some years. In 2006, Mark Protosevich was signed by Marvel to develop the film adaptation.

Facts about Thor 4: the director
At first, Matthew Vaughn was signed as the director the movie for a tentative 2010 movie release. However, Branagh was selected to direct to the movie in 2011.
Facts about Thor 5: the principal photography
The principal photography occurred in January to May 2010 in California and New Mexico. In 2009, the cast of the movie was finalized.

Facts about Thor 6: the premiere
On 17th April 2011, the premier of Thor took place in Sydney, Australia. On 6th May 2011, it was released in US. It was a commercially successful movie. Hemsworth and other stars in the movie receive the praise from the critics. However, the movie was still criticized due to the earth-based elements.

Facts about Thor 7: the sequels
Since Thor is a successful movie, it has been adapted into sequels. On 8 November 2013, Thor: The Dark World is released in the market. On 3rd November 2017, Thor: Ragnarok was released. The latter one is considered as the most successful one.
Facts about Thor 8: Chris Hemsworth
Chris Hemsworth took the role as Thor. At first, the actor was dropped from the project. He was reconsidered again and got the second chance. He had to increase his weight to match up with the role.

Facts about Thor 9: other characters
Natalie Portman took the role as Jane Foster. She became the love interest of Thor. Loki is also an important character in the movie. He was portrayed by Tom Hiddleston. At first, he had an audition for the role of Thor. However, he ended up as Loki.

Facts about Thor 10: a Thor Panel
A Thor Panel took place at 2010 San Diego Comic-Con International in July 2010 to promote the movie where the primary cast along with the director was present.
